The Facilities & Workplace Services Officer is key to the delivery of the Intelligent Client Function by Defra Group Property and provides reassurance on statutory duties and compliance and maintaining and enhancing good working relationships with both customers and the service provider.
Support the Facilities & Workplace Service Lead for the hub to;
- Work with local stakeholders to understand their current and future workplace requirements.
- Interface with the FM service providers to ensure and facilitate a seamless facilities management service provision.
- Provide assurance to stakeholders that the workplaces occupied by their staff and visitors are legally compliant and safe.
- Manage health and safety, premises maintenance, Business Continuity arrangements, identifying any remedial actions and acting upon them.
Please note this role is based at Defra's Newcastle Office, NE4 7YH. Travel to other sites and overnight stays may be required for meetings or training events.
